    <In a span of a few minutes early in the day, two dealers in separate conversations volunteered that they no longer bid in auctions at all, since they feel like they get better deals on the bourse floor. We don’t agree with that, and think our best approach is to buy cool coins wherever we find them, but maybe it is different in other specialities.>

    Ive been thinking this very thing! With everyone and their moms bidding on Heritage auctions, its more of a retail place than a wholesale venue. Judging by the many threads of, "My newp I won, but I paid too much" here on this forum, most will probably agree.
